Posting about trends outside your niche can help you reach new people, but it should still relate to your main topic in some way. If the trend connects to your audience's interests or teaches a lesson that supports your niche, it can add freshness to your page. But when the trend has no link to what you do, it may confuse your followers and weaken your message. A good approach is to join trends only when you can add something useful or give a simple explanation that ties back to your core content. This keeps your page focused while still feeling current.
